WebNov 3, 2024 · SQL Server supports various data types for storing different kinds of data. These data types store characters, numeric, decimal, string, binary, CLR and Spatial data types. Once you connect to a database in SSMS, you can view these data types by navigating to Programmability-> Types->System Data Types. WebDec 30, 2024 · Azure SQL Database (with the exception of Azure SQL Managed Instance) and Azure Synapse Analytics follow UTC. Use AT TIME ZONE in Azure SQL Database or Azure Synapse Analytics if you need to interpret date and time information in a non-UTC time zone..
